Common Sliding & Patio Doors Problems We See in Ridge Manor Homes
- Rollers binding from sand and organic debris. Open-lot grading and unpaved driveways mean fine sand packs into door tracks. Rollers bind, the slab jumps off its track, and the lock stops engaging. We clean, rebuild, and realign tracks so the door rolls on its bearings, not on grit.
- Threshold rot from Green Swamp ground moisture. Ridge Manor’s persistent high relative humidity near the Green Swamp accelerates wood-frame rot at door thresholds and sills. We see sagging slabs and broken latch alignment in as little as eight to ten years on homes that never had proper flashing installed.
- Leak paths at sill corners on manufactured homes. This is the failure mode almost unique to Ridge Manor. Older manufactured homes often had sliding doors swapped in without flashing tape or proper anchoring to the thin aluminum wall system. Water finds its way in at the sill corners, and by the time you notice the staining, the subfloor is already compromised.
- Non-standard openings from HUD-code structures. Many Ridge Manor homes have rough openings that don’t match any stock door at the supply house. Big-box replacements simply won’t fit, and some won’t meet Florida Building Code anchoring requirements for HUD-code structures. We measure twice and order custom-sized units when the opening requires it.

Ridge Manor Permitting and Site Conditions That Change Your Door Quote
Ridge Manor is unincorporated Hernando County, which means county permitting, not city. That changes the timeline and sometimes the scope. We pull permits and pass inspections on every job that requires one. Septic and well setbacks on larger rural lots can restrict where equipment can sit and how we access the opening. Open lots with grading and drainage issues mean long material carries and sometimes site prep before a door can be set. None of this is mysterious to us. We scope it before quoting. If your home is an older manufactured unit, we’ll check the anchoring and wall structure before recommending a door system. The best package for Ridge Manor’s climate is a low-E insulated glass unit with a warm-edge spacer and a vinyl or aluminum frame with a thermal break. High humidity near the Green Swamp means condensation forms quickly on single-pane glass and bare aluminum frames. A thermal break reduces that condensation and slows the internal corrosion that eventually kills the rollers and latch hardware.
